Study Summary

This is a first-in-human, modular, Phase I/IIa, open-label, multi-centre study to assess the safety, tolerability, PK, and preliminary efficacy of AZD0022 monotherapy in combination with other anti-cancer agents in participants with tumours harbouring a KRASG12D mutation.

Primary Outcome

Determine if treatment with AZD0022 as a monotherapy and in combination with other anti-cancer agents is safe and tolerable through the assessment of DLTs, AEs, SAEs, and change from baseline in laboratory parameters, vital signs, and ECGs. Part A (Dose Escalation) and Part B (Dose Optimisation). DLTs only applicable for Part A.

Interventions

  • DRUG Cetuximab
  • DRUG AZD0022
